What are the fees associated with buying crypto on Webull?
Can you please provide a detailed explanation of the fees associated with buying cryptocurrencies on the Webull platform? I would like to know the different types of fees, their amounts, and how they are calculated.
3 answers
- Sneha PanthiJun 13, 2024 · 2 years agoWhen it comes to buying cryptocurrencies on Webull, there are a few fees you should be aware of. Firstly, there is a trading fee which is charged when you buy or sell crypto. The trading fee is typically a percentage of the transaction amount and can vary depending on the specific cryptocurrency you are trading. Additionally, there may be a deposit fee if you are funding your account with fiat currency. This fee is usually a fixed amount or a percentage of the deposit. Lastly, there might be withdrawal fees if you decide to transfer your crypto assets out of the Webull platform. These fees can also vary depending on the cryptocurrency and the amount you are withdrawing. It's important to note that the fees mentioned here are specific to Webull and may differ from other cryptocurrency exchanges.
